public DeleteVolumeRequest build()
Build the instance of DeleteVolumeRequest as configured by this builder
Note that this method takes calls to invocationCallback(com.oracle.bmc.util.internal.Consumer)
into account, while the method buildWithoutInvocationCallback()
does not.
This is the preferred method to build an instance.
